sharers are big spenders too
People who download music illegally also spend an average of 77 a year buying it legitimately, a survey has found. Those who claimed not to use peer-to-peer filesharing sites such as The Pirate Bay spent a yearly average of just 44. Almost one in 10 of those questioned aged between 16 and 50 ...
